I have just finished vetoing a bill which was intended to emasculate the Labor Department, and the Congress has just passed it over my veto.
Said by
Harry Truman
Democratic · Missouri

Editor's note · Context

Rear Platform Remarks in Missouri, Illinois, Indiana, and Ohio
